Guidehouse supports the Science Based Targets initiative in developing a guide to meet greenhouse gas emissions reduction targets
Electric utilities play a crucial role in decarbonization and helping to meet the flagship goal of the Paris Agreement, limiting global warming to 1.5°C.
Guidehouse, in partnership with the Carbon Disclosure Project (CDP), created Setting 1.5°C-Aligned Science-Based Targets: Quick Start Guide for Electric Utilities, on behalf of the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i).
The guide supports electric utilities in setting science-based targets that meet sector-specific requirements through a four-step process:
Guidehouse and CDP also created a Science-based Target Setting Tool enabling electric utilities to submit 1.5°C-aligned targets to the SBTi for validation.
